The Curly Girl Method Perspective: Ingredient Integrity for Textured Hair
For followers of the Curly Girl Method (CGM), ingredient scrutiny is paramount. The product's designation as a "Super Conditioning Hair Gloss" immediately suggests a formulation focused on moisture and hair health, which generally aligns well with CGM principles. However, without a full ingredient list readily available, a definitive judgment on its 100% CGM compliance remains cautiously optimistic. True compatibility hinges on the absence of sulfates, non-water-soluble silicones, drying alcohols, and waxes—ingredients known to cause build-up, dryness, or frizz on curly hair. Sulfates, for instance, are harsh detergents that can strip the hair of its natural protective oils, leading to dehydration and breakage, especially problematic for naturally drier curl patterns. Non-water-soluble silicones create a temporary smooth feel but can prevent moisture from penetrating the hair shaft over time, forming an occlusive layer that requires strong sulfates to remove. Drying alcohols, often found in styling products, can also exacerbate dryness and lead to brittle strands. Checking the formulation for these specific components is crucial for any diligent CGM adherent. This careful review is essential.
This gloss aims to enhance natural texture without compromising hair integrity. It promises nourishment and repair. Unlike many traditional oxidative hair dyes that penetrate the hair shaft and can strip hair of its natural oils and moisture, a conditioning gloss typically works by depositing color pigments on the hair's surface while infusing it with hydrating agents. This approach minimizes potential damage, making it a more curl-friendly option for color refreshment. The visible "glaze texture" in the product imagery implies a smooth, easy-to-distribute formula, which is essential for even application on textured hair, preventing patchy results where curls might clump unevenly and absorb color differently. Consistent coverage is key.
The conditioning aspect is particularly beneficial for curls, which are inherently more prone to dryness and require consistent hydration to maintain their structure and elasticity. A gloss that actively conditions can help to smooth the cuticle, reduce friction, and improve overall manageability. This supports curl definition.

For individuals with lighter hair bases, shades like 'Copper Crush' or 'Grape Purple' will yield the most vibrant and true-to-swatch results, as the underlying lightness allows the deposited pigments to show through clearly. On darker hair, these shades might create a subtle, luminous tint or a rich undertone rather than a dramatic color change, primarily adding depth and an intense shine. Understanding your base color is crucial.

Longevity and Flexible Color Commitment
As a semi-permanent gloss, its color gradually fades over several washes, typically between 4-6 shampoos. This characteristic offers significant flexibility. Users can switch shades more frequently or return to their natural color without a harsh grow-out line or the need for a color correction process. Regular reapplication is necessary to maintain the desired vibrancy, typically every few weeks as the previous application begins to diminish. The fading is gentle and even.
This gradual fading process is a deliberate design choice, catering to those who prefer lower commitment compared to permanent dyes. For individuals who enjoy changing their look or simply want to refresh their existing color between salon appointments, this offers a practical and less damaging solution. Factors influencing longevity include the frequency of washing, the temperature of the water used (cooler water helps preserve color), and the type of shampoo and conditioner employed (sulfate-free products are generally recommended for color-treated hair). Potential Trade-offs and Considerations for Informed Choice
While the benefits are clear, it is important to manage expectations regarding semi-permanent color. This gloss will not drastically lighten hair or provide full gray coverage, especially on resistant gray strands. Its primary function is to enhance, enrich, and add shine to existing hair color. For those seeking a complete color overhaul, significant lightening, or opaque gray coverage, a different product category, such as permanent dyes or professional lightening services, might be more suitable. This is a subtle enhancer.

Another consideration is the potential for staining. While typically less aggressive than permanent dyes, semi-permanent colors can temporarily stain skin or porous surfaces. Taking precautions like wearing gloves and protecting surrounding areas is advisable.
